FoxNext Games’ mobile game Marvel Strike Force is out today. It’s a free-to-play squad-based action game featuring a selection of 70 Marvel heroes and villains, including Captain America, Doctor Strange, Iron Man, Spider-Man and Wolverine.
Players select their squad, upgrading each member as they combat bad guys. You’ll get the general idea from the trailer, also released today.
Marvel Strike Force is the first game from FoxNext, which is a gaming subsidiary of Fox. The outfit was set up last year, with access to Twentieth Century Fox Film and Fox Networks Group franchises. It’s also working on a game based on the Alien movies.
Marvel Strike Force is available for Android and iOS, with in-game microtransactions. FoxNext says its Los Angeles-based development team is working on more missions and characters to be released in the future.
